For those who don't know about this timer, it is a in-car track lap timing device, similar to the Longacre Hot Lap or the AIM My-Chron.
Ultra-Lap separates itself from the competition by offering such features as:
- Auto-on/off
- Easy English menu driven display with heavy customization abilities
- Storage of up to 2000 laps with track session identification
- Fastest/slowest/average lap times with real time indicators of lap pace vs avg.
- Segment times can be recorded
- Can download data to computer via USB cable for extensive post session analysis
- Low power consumption, receiver uses just one AA battery.
- 6 feet of installation cable for ease/flexibility of in-car mounting options
